From mboxrd@z Thu Jan 1 00:00:00 1970 From: "Alan E. Davis" Subject: Re: Project definition (WAS: Re: Emacs-orgmode Digest, Vol 37, Issue 121--) Date: Tue, 31 Mar 2009 14:59:04 +1000 Message-ID: <7bef1f890903302159j47c9f80fs75256ee72db6f9f7@mail.g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Return-path: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1LoW4O-0008Gz-9q for emacs-orgmode@gnu.org; Tue, 31 Mar 2009 00:59:28 -0400 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1LoW4I-0008AL-1O for emacs-orgmode@gnu.org; Tue, 31 Mar 2009 00:59:27 -0400 Received: from [199.232.76.173] (port=52570 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1LoW4H-0008AB-To for emacs-orgmode@gnu.org; Tue, 31 Mar 2009 00:59:21 -0400 Received: from rv-out-0708.google.com ([209.85.198.245]:40592)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1LoW4H-0001R0-4W for emacs-orgmode@gnu.org; Tue, 31 Mar 2009 00:59:21 -0400 Received: by rv-out-0708.google.com with SMTP id f25so3363804rvb.6 for ; Mon, 30 Mar 2009 21:59:19 -0700 (PDT) List-Id: "General discussions about Org-mode."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org Errors-To: emacs-orgmode-bounces+geo-emacs-orgmode=m.gmane.org@gnu.org To: Eraldo Helal Cc: emacs-orgmode@gnu.org, Robert Goldman Hello: On Mon, Mar 30, 2009 at 1:39 AM, Eraldo Helal wrote: >> An interesting question would be how to generalize this to update >> remember templates accordingly. =A0Possibly the best approach would be t= o >> have a defining form that would define a project in a single >> s-expression, adding both remember templates and agenda entries, and >> then that form could be removed all at once. =A0Something like >> >> (org-add-project newproj >> =A0"A sample new project to show the greatness of org-add-project." >> =A0(agenda-files (find-lisp-find-files "~/newproj/" "\.org$")) >> =A0(remember-templates >> =A0 =A0 ....)) >> [The generic subject line made it difficult to find again] This idea has great possibilities. I have wanted some way to define a project that would insert a link in a master file. Alan